Elderly individuals often face challenges when it comes to mobility and accessing basic amenities such as a toilet. A mobile toilet for elderly individuals can provide them with much-needed convenience and independence. These portable toilets are designed to be easily moved from room to room, making it easier for seniors to maintain their personal hygiene and dignity. In this article, we will explore the numerous benefits of using a mobile toilet for elderly individuals.
One of the main advantages of a mobile toilet for elderly individuals is that it can be placed wherever it is most convenient for the user. This is especially beneficial for seniors who may have difficulty walking long distances or navigating narrow hallways to reach a traditional bathroom. With a mobile toilet, elderly individuals can have easy access to a toilet without having to rely on the assistance of a caregiver or family member.
Another benefit of a mobile toilet for elderly individuals is that it provides them with a sense of independence and privacy. Many seniors feel embarrassed or self-conscious about needing help with personal care tasks, such as using the bathroom. Having a portable toilet allows elderly individuals to maintain their dignity and autonomy by being able to use the toilet on their own terms.
Furthermore, mobile toilets for elderly individuals are designed with comfort and convenience in mind. These portable toilets are typically equipped with features such as adjustable height, padded seats, and armrests for added support. This makes it easier for seniors to get on and off the toilet safely and comfortably, reducing the risk of falls and injuries.
In addition to providing convenience and comfort, a mobile toilet for elderly individuals can also help to improve their overall health and well-being. Many seniors experience bladder and bowel control issues as they age, which can be exacerbated by mobility limitations. Having a portable toilet close by can encourage elderly individuals to stay hydrated and maintain regular toileting habits, which can help to prevent urinary tract infections and other health problems.
Another important benefit of using a mobile toilet for elderly individuals is that it can help to reduce the risk of accidents and injuries. Falls are a leading cause of injury among seniors, especially in the bathroom where slippery floors and awkward toilet placements can increase the risk of falls. By using a portable toilet, elderly individuals can eliminate the need to navigate a potentially hazardous bathroom environment, reducing their risk of injury and improving their overall safety.
